Upstream version 5.34.104.0
[platform/framework/web/crosswalk.git] / src / third_party / WebKit / Source / web / web.gypi
index 44284a9..f102558 100644 (file)
@@ -6,8 +6,6 @@
       'AssertMatchingEnums.cpp',
       'AssociatedURLLoader.cpp',
       'AssociatedURLLoader.h',
-      'AutofillPopupMenuClient.cpp',
-      'AutofillPopupMenuClient.h',
       'BackForwardClientImpl.cpp',
       'BackForwardClientImpl.h',
       'ChromeClientImpl.cpp',
@@ -25,7 +23,8 @@
       'ContextMenuClientImpl.h',
       'DOMUtilitiesPrivate.cpp',
       'DOMUtilitiesPrivate.h',
-      'DatabaseObserver.cpp',
+      'DatabaseClientImpl.cpp',
+      'DatabaseClientImpl.h',
       'DateTimeChooserImpl.cpp',
       'DateTimeChooserImpl.h',
       'DragClientImpl.cpp',
       'GeolocationClientProxy.h',
       'GraphicsLayerFactoryChromium.cpp',
       'GraphicsLayerFactoryChromium.h',
-      'IDBCursorBackendProxy.cpp',
-      'IDBCursorBackendProxy.h',
-      'IDBDatabaseBackendProxy.cpp',
-      'IDBDatabaseBackendProxy.h',
       'IDBFactoryBackendProxy.cpp',
       'IDBFactoryBackendProxy.h',
-      'InbandTextTrackPrivateImpl.cpp',
-      'InbandTextTrackPrivateImpl.h',
       'InspectorClientImpl.cpp',
       'InspectorClientImpl.h',
       'InspectorFrontendClientImpl.cpp',
@@ -66,8 +59,6 @@
       'LocalFileSystemClient.h',
       'MIDIClientProxy.cpp',
       'MIDIClientProxy.h',
-      'MediaSourcePrivateImpl.cpp',
-      'MediaSourcePrivateImpl.h',
       'NotificationPresenterImpl.cpp',
       'NotificationPresenterImpl.h',
       'PageOverlay.cpp',
       'PrerendererClientImpl.h',
       'ScrollbarGroup.cpp',
       'ScrollbarGroup.h',
+      'ServiceWorkerGlobalScopeClientImpl.cpp',
+      'ServiceWorkerGlobalScopeClientImpl.h',
+      'ServiceWorkerGlobalScopeProxy.cpp',
+      'ServiceWorkerGlobalScopeProxy.h',
       'SharedWorkerRepositoryClientImpl.cpp',
       'SharedWorkerRepositoryClientImpl.h',
-      'SourceBufferPrivateImpl.cpp',
-      'SourceBufferPrivateImpl.h',
       'SpeechInputClientImpl.cpp',
       'SpeechInputClientImpl.h',
       'SpeechRecognitionClientProxy.cpp',
       'SpeechRecognitionClientProxy.h',
-      'StorageAreaProxy.cpp',
-      'StorageAreaProxy.h',
-      'StorageNamespaceProxy.cpp',
-      'StorageNamespaceProxy.h',
-      'StorageQuotaChromium.cpp',
+      'SpellCheckerClientImpl.cpp',
+      'SpellCheckerClientImpl.h',
+      'StorageClientImpl.cpp',
+      'StorageClientImpl.h',
+      'StorageQuotaClientImpl.cpp',
+      'StorageQuotaClientImpl.h',
       'UserMediaClientImpl.cpp',
       'UserMediaClientImpl.h',
       'ValidationMessageClientImpl.cpp',
       'ViewportAnchor.cpp',
       'ViewportAnchor.h',
       'WebAXObject.cpp',
+      'WebArrayBufferConverter.cpp',
       'WebArrayBufferView.cpp',
       'WebBindings.cpp',
       'WebBlob.cpp',
       'WebCache.cpp',
       'WebCachedURLRequest.cpp',
       'WebColorName.cpp',
+      'WebColorSuggestion.cpp',
       'WebCrossOriginPreflightResultCache.cpp',
       'WebCustomElement.cpp',
       'WebDOMActivityLogger.cpp',
       'WebDOMEventListenerPrivate.cpp',
       'WebDOMEventListenerPrivate.h',
       'WebDOMFileSystem.cpp',
+      'WebDOMMediaStreamTrack.cpp',
       'WebDOMMessageEvent.cpp',
       'WebDOMMouseEvent.cpp',
       'WebDOMProgressEvent.cpp',
       'WebDOMResourceProgressEvent.cpp',
+      'WebDateTimeSuggestion.cpp',
       'WebDataSourceImpl.cpp',
       'WebDataSourceImpl.h',
       'WebDatabase.cpp',
       'WebDocumentType.cpp',
       'WebDragData.cpp',
       'WebElement.cpp',
+      'WebElementCollection.cpp',
+      'WebEmbeddedWorkerImpl.cpp',
+      'WebEmbeddedWorkerImpl.h',
       'WebEntities.cpp',
       'WebEntities.h',
       'WebFileChooserCompletionImpl.cpp',
       'WebFormElement.cpp',
       'WebFrameImpl.cpp',
       'WebFrameImpl.h',
-      'WebGeolocationClientMock.cpp',
       'WebGeolocationController.cpp',
       'WebGeolocationError.cpp',
       'WebGeolocationPermissionRequest.cpp',
       'WebGeolocationPermissionRequestManager.cpp',
       'WebGeolocationPosition.cpp',
       'WebGlyphCache.cpp',
+      'WebHeap.cpp',
       'WebHelperPluginImpl.cpp',
       'WebHelperPluginImpl.h',
       'WebHistoryItem.cpp',
       'WebHitTestResult.cpp',
-      'WebIDBCallbacksImpl.cpp',
-      'WebIDBCallbacksImpl.h',
-      'WebIDBDatabaseCallbacksImpl.cpp',
-      'WebIDBDatabaseCallbacksImpl.h',
       'WebIDBDatabaseError.cpp',
       'WebIDBKey.cpp',
       'WebIDBKeyPath.cpp',
       'WebIDBMetadata.cpp',
       'WebImageCache.cpp',
       'WebImageDecoder.cpp',
-      'WebImageSkia.cpp',
       'WebInputElement.cpp',
       'WebInputEvent.cpp',
       'WebInputEventFactoryAndroid.cpp',
       'WebInputEventConversion.h',
       'WebKit.cpp',
       'WebLabelElement.cpp',
+      'WebLeakDetector.cpp',
       'WebMIDIClientMock.cpp',
       'WebMIDIPermissionRequest.cpp',
+      'WebMediaDevicesRequest.cpp',
       'WebMediaPlayerClientImpl.cpp',
       'WebMediaPlayerClientImpl.h',
       'WebMediaStreamRegistry.cpp',
       'WebNetworkStateNotifier.cpp',
       'WebNode.cpp',
-      'WebNodeCollection.cpp',
       'WebNodeList.cpp',
       'WebNotification.cpp',
       'WebOptionElement.cpp',
       'WebScopedMicrotaskSuppression.cpp',
       'WebScopedUserGesture.cpp',
       'WebScopedUserGesture.cpp',
+      'WebScopedWindowFocusAllowedIndicator.cpp',
       'WebScriptBindings.cpp',
       'WebScriptController.cpp',
       'WebScrollbarThemePainter.cpp',
       'WebUserMediaRequest.cpp',
       'WebViewImpl.cpp',
       'WebViewImpl.h',
-      'WebWorkerBase.cpp',
-      'WebWorkerBase.h',
-      'WebWorkerClientImpl.cpp',
-      'WebWorkerClientImpl.h',
       'WebWorkerInfo.cpp',
       'WebWorkerRunLoop.cpp',
-      'WorkerAllowMainThreadBridgeBase.cpp',
-      'WorkerAllowMainThreadBridgeBase.h',
-      'WorkerFileSystemClient.cpp',
-      'WorkerFileSystemClient.h',
+      'WorkerGlobalScopeProxyProviderImpl.cpp',
+      'WorkerGlobalScopeProxyProviderImpl.h',
       'WorkerPermissionClient.cpp',
       'WorkerPermissionClient.h',
       'default/WebRenderTheme.cpp',
-      'linux/WebFontInfo.cpp',
-      'linux/WebFontRenderStyle.cpp',
       'linux/WebFontRendering.cpp',
+      'mac/WebScrollbarTheme.mm',
       'mac/WebSubstringUtil.mm',
       'painting/ContinuousPainter.cpp',
       'painting/ContinuousPainter.h',
     ],
     'web_unittest_files': [
       'tests/AssociatedURLLoaderTest.cpp',
+      'tests/BitmapImageTest.cpp',
+      'tests/Canvas2DLayerBridgeTest.cpp',
+      'tests/Canvas2DLayerManagerTest.cpp',
       'tests/ChromeClientImplTest.cpp',
       'tests/CompositedLayerMappingTest.cpp',
       'tests/CustomEventTest.cpp',
       'tests/DragImageTest.cpp',
+      'tests/DrawingBufferTest.cpp',
       'tests/FakeWebPlugin.cpp',
       'tests/FakeWebPlugin.h',
       'tests/FilterOperationsTest.cpp',
       'tests/FrameLoaderClientImplTest.cpp',
       'tests/FrameTestHelpers.cpp',
       'tests/FrameTestHelpers.h',
+      'tests/GIFImageDecoderTest.cpp',
+      'tests/GraphicsContextTest.cpp',
       'tests/GraphicsLayerTest.cpp',
       'tests/ImageFilterBuilderTest.cpp',
       'tests/ImageLayerChromiumTest.cpp',
+      'tests/JPEGImageDecoderTest.cpp',
       'tests/KeyboardTest.cpp',
       'tests/LinkHighlightTest.cpp',
       'tests/ListenerLeakTest.cpp',
       'tests/MemoryInfo.cpp',
+      'tests/MockWebGraphicsContext3D.h',
       'tests/OpaqueRectTrackingContentLayerDelegateTest.cpp',
       'tests/OpenTypeVerticalDataTest.cpp',
       'tests/PageSerializerTest.cpp',
       'tests/PaintAggregatorTest.cpp',
       'tests/PopupContainerTest.cpp',
+      'tests/PopupMenuTest.cpp',
       'tests/PrerenderingTest.cpp',
       'tests/ProgrammaticScrollTest.cpp',
       'tests/RenderTableCellTest.cpp',
       'tests/RenderTableRowTest.cpp',
       'tests/ScrollingCoordinatorChromiumTest.cpp',
+      'tests/SpinLockTest.cpp',
+      'tests/TouchActionTest.cpp',
       'tests/URLTestHelpers.cpp',
       'tests/URLTestHelpers.h',
       'tests/ViewportTest.cpp',
       'tests/WebImageTest.cpp',
       'tests/WebInputEventConversionTest.cpp',
       'tests/WebInputEventFactoryTestMac.mm',
+      'tests/WEBPImageDecoderTest.cpp',
       'tests/WebPageNewSerializerTest.cpp',
       'tests/WebPageSerializerTest.cpp',
       'tests/WebPluginContainerTest.cpp',
+      'tests/WebScopedWindowFocusAllowedIndicatorTest.cpp',
+      'tests/WebSearchableFormDataTest.cpp',
       'tests/WebSelectorTest.cpp',
       'tests/WebURLRequestTest.cpp',
       'tests/WebURLResponseTest.cpp',
         {
           'web_unittest_files': [
             'tests/LocaleWinTest.cpp',
-            # FIXME: Port PopupMenuTest to Linux and Mac.
-            'tests/PopupMenuTest.cpp',
-            'tests/TransparencyWinTest.cpp',
             'tests/WebPageNewSerializerTest.cpp',
             'tests/WebPageSerializerTest.cpp',
           ],